#3a4180 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a4180 is composed of 22.7% red, 25.5%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.7% cyan, 49.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 234 degrees, a saturation of 37.6% and a lightness of 36.5%. #3a4180 color hex could be obtained by blending #7482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3a4180 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a4180 has RGB values of R:58, G:65,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 3817856.

Shades and Tints of #3a4180
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030307 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a4180
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575863 is the less saturated color, while #0113b9 is the most saturated one.
